Music from the Movement

To celebrate Black History Month, we are happy to bring together some of our favorite musicians to celebrate the rich, soul-stirring music from the Civil Rights Movement. These “marching songs,” as they were often called, played a pivotal role in keeping thousands of oppressed people inspired and marching forward in the face of brutal attacks. Through this performance, we hope to remind our fellow Atlantans how far we’ve come and to inspire them to keep marching onward, as we have yet to reach MLK’s “mountaintop.”
